Square Enix will be launching a free demo for the upcoming Theatrhythm Final Bar Line on February 1. According to the company, player progress will carry over into the full game, currently scheduled to be released on February 16. Square Enix will be holding a livestream showcasing the game on January 30.This will be the latest addition to the Theatrhythm series which benefits from a large following on account of its unique blend of roleplaying elements and musical mechanics. The first entry was released on February 16, 2012 for the Nintendo 3DS. Theatrhythm Final Bar Line will feature classic songs including One Winged Angel, Mambo de Chocobo, and Aerith's Theme. The demo is going to have a selection of 30 tracks.

Players will get to experience three separate Music Stages consisting of Field Music, Battle Music, and Event Music. The modes each have their own style of gameplay, offering players a slightly different experience. Field Music for example is a relaxed mode featuring themed landscapes, while Battle Music is a faster paced and more intense mode requiring quick reflexes.

Theatrhythm is known for the outstanding quality of its graphics and animation. The games feature beautiful environments, colorful characters, and fluid movesets which nicely complement their music. The first and so far most popular entry in the series, Theatrhythm Final Fantasy, was praised for its large selection of soundtracks, offering players a satisfying second look at some of their favorite moments.
